How Long to Bake Cupcakes at 350

How Long to Bake Cupcakes at 350

Baking cupcakes can be a fun and rewarding experience, but it can also be frustrating if you don't know the correct baking time and temperature. If you're wondering how long to bake cupcakes at 350 degrees Fahrenheit, the answer is typically between 18 to 22 minutes.

However, it's important to note that baking times can vary depending on the recipe, oven, and altitude. To ensure that your cupcakes are perfectly baked, keep an eye on them after 18 minutes and use the toothpick or touch test (more on these later) to determine if they're done.

If your cupcakes are still not done after 22 minutes, you can continue to bake them in 2-3 minute intervals until they're fully baked. Just remember to not open the oven door too often as this can cause temperature fluctuations and affect the baking time.

How Long to Bake Cupcakes at 325

If you prefer to bake your cupcakes at a lower temperature, you may be wondering how long to bake cupcakes at 325 degrees Fahrenheit. Typically, cupcakes baked at 325 degrees Fahrenheit take longer to bake compared to those baked at 350 degrees Fahrenheit.

The average baking time for cupcakes at 325 degrees Fahrenheit is around 20 to 24 minutes. However, as with any baking recipe, it's always best to keep a close eye on your cupcakes and use the toothpick or touch test to ensure they are baked to perfection.

How to Check Cupcakes for Doneness

Checking cupcakes for doneness is essential to ensure that they're not undercooked or overcooked. There are two main methods that bakers use to check cupcakes for doneness: the toothpick test and the touch test.

To use the toothpick test, insert a toothpick into the center of one of the cupcakes. If the toothpick comes out clean, without any batter sticking to it, then the cupcakes are fully baked. If there is still batter or crumbs on the toothpick, continue baking the cupcakes for a few more minutes and retest until they come out clean.

To use the touch test, gently touch the top of one of your cupcakes with your finger. If it springs back up, then the cupcakes are fully baked. If the tops of the cupcakes sink in or feel wet, then the cupcakes are not fully baked and should be returned to the oven for additional time.

Is it better to bake a cake at 325 or 350?

The ideal baking temperature for a cake can vary depending on the recipe, oven, and altitude. In general, most cake recipes call for baking at 350 degrees Fahrenheit.

However, some bakers prefer to bake their cakes at 325 degrees Fahrenheit to help prevent the edges from becoming too brown or dry. Ultimately, the best temperature for baking a cake will depend on the specific recipe and the desired outcome.
